Mercedes Scelba-Shorte in Subway Commercial

January 7, 2009 by Erin Balser  

Mercedes Scelba-Shorte is in one of the commercials from Subway’s “Five Dollar Foot Long campaign.” The campaign features campy situations where various instances, like a cop stopping a woman on a moped, inadvertently indicate a foot-long sub. I think the commercials are cute and fun, but I’ve seen it too many times.

Mercedes isn’t in the main commercials of this campaign, but rather one that features construction workers, firefighters and secretaries singing the five dollar footlong song.

It’s nice to see Mercedes getting work in a national campaign. The fact she’s recognizable takes away from the purpose of this commercial-we now know they are actors, as opposed to real people asked to sing-but that’s minor!
